My girlfriend and i just went out to look at a camaro today and she is going to buy it for herself. Its a 1991 Camaro B4C. (yes i checked the rpo sticker and the car over to make sure) it needs bodywork but i can do that. it runs good, tranny shifts fine, everything works. L98 with 125,xxx miles. all it needs is a gas line fix, and new tires to be able to pass inspection. Interior is in good shape. Needs a driver door as well. Car is solid otherwise. Cost $700. What do you guys think?

700 could be a steal, but with the rust issues that are visible, it would be safe to assume the floors are in bad shape. I would take the time to really go over the car, especially underneath and make sure the floors are not rotted out. If they are, its going to be a nightmare.
And being a cop car, the drivetrain is most likely shot.
